Welcome on the website of the ANR project SIERRA devoted to Spectral efficient Receivers and Resource Allocation for Cognitive Satellite communications.

The main objective of SIERRA is to perform resource allocation to maximize the throughput (or other relevant objective functions) while satisfying the interference temperature limits regarding the primary systems by taking into account non-linear impairments due to satellite components.

The duration of the project is 42 months from March 15, 2018 to September 15, 2021.
